
The largest of all moose is the alaskan race. The scientific name for moose is alces alces, for the alaskan species it is alces alces gigas.
FACTS
Type: Mammal
Diet: Herbivore
Average lifespan in the wild: 15 to 20 years
Size: Height at shoulder, 5 to 6.5 ft (1.5 to 2 m)
Weight: 1,800 lbs (820 kg)Group name: Herd
